Emily Ricketts, a personal trainer who candidly shared her experience gaining over 50 pounds during pregnancy, recently opened up about how kindness to herself—rather than rushing to lose weight—made her postpartum fitness journey sustainable and more empowering (source).
This fresh perspective challenges the long-held societal myth that mothers should quickly shed pregnancy weight to regain their “pre-baby” shape. Instead, Emily found motivation in embracing the fact that postpartum fitness meant starting over—feeling like a beginner again. And that mindset shift made all the difference.
Why This Matters for Fertility and Wellness
Pregnancy and postpartum are not just physically transformative; they’re deeply emotional and hormonal experiences that impact fertility long before and after conception. For many trying to conceive, wellness is a delicate balance of physical, mental, and emotional health.
But how often do we talk about being kind to ourselves during this vulnerable time? And how could this kindness potentially influence fertility outcomes?
From a data-driven standpoint, research shows that chronic stress and negative body image can disrupt hormonal balance and ovulation cycles, making conception more challenging. Conversely, positive self-perception and mental wellness correlate with healthier reproductive hormones.
